A painless red swollen bump around the anus that has been present for 3 days without itching is most commonly an external haemorrhoid (pile), a skin tag, or a small cyst. These are very common and are generally not dangerous. An external pile can appear as a soft, reddish swelling around the anal opening, especially after straining, constipation, or prolonged sitting. The fact that it is not painful and not itching is a good sign.
